1. zookeeper安装(单机版):http://www.cnblogs.com/wangfajun/p/5251159.html  √

注意:我这里的dubbo-admin.war是2.5.3版本的,如果是服务器是JDK1.8的,则需要修改tomcat-8运行时指定JDK为1.7的版本,在catalina.sh、setclasspath.sh 两个文件里的头部加入下面两行:

export JAVA_HOME=/root/install/jdk1.7.0_79
export JRE_HOME=/root/install/jdk1.7.0_79/jre

2. 安装dubbo的管控台(本篇介绍的是管理单机版的zookeeper,后续会写如何配置集群的zookeeper):

注:

①: Dubbo管控台可以对注册到zookeeper注册中心的服务或者服务的消费者进行管理

②: 管控台是否正常对Dubbo服务没有任何影响

③: 管控台不需要高可用,可单节点部署

环境:Centos6.6、jdk1.6、apache-tomcat-7.0.61、ip:192.168.29.128

1:下载 Tomcat7 并将其解压到/home/wangfajun/ 目录下,重命名为dubbo-admin-tomcat:

$ tar -zxvf apache-tomcat-7.0.61.tar.gz

$ mv apache-tomcat-7.0.61 dubbo-admin-tomcat

2:移除 /home/wangfajun/dubbo-admin-tomcat/webapps目录下所有文件:

$ rm -rf *

3:上传Dubbo管控台程序dubbo-admin-2.5.3.war 到/home/wangfajun/dubbo-admin-tomcat/webapps下

4:解压管控台war包并将其命名为ROOT

$ unzip dubbo-admin-2.5.3.war -d ROOT

5:配置 dubbo.properties

$ vi ROOT/WEB-INF/dubbo.properties

dubbo.registry.address=zookkeeper://192.168.29.128:2181

dubbo.admin.root.password=wangfajun

dubbo.admin.guest.password=wangfajun

注: 密码在上生产的时候最好改成复杂点的

6:防火墙开启8080端口,用root用户修改/etc/sysconfig/iptables

# vi /etc/sysconfig/iptables 增加以下内容:

# dubbo-admin-tomcat:8080

-A INPUT -m state --state NEW -m tcp -p tcp --dport 8080 -j ACCEPT

7:重启防火墙:

# service iptables restart

8:启动 Tomcat7 :

$ /home/wangfajun/dubbo-admin-tomcat/bin/startup.sh

9浏览 http://192.168.29.128:8080/

10:配置Tomcat开机启动:

# vi /etc/rc.local文件,加入

su - wangfajun -c '/home/wangfajun/dubbo-admin-tomcat/bin/startup.sh'

Dubbo管控台安装(zookeeper单机版)的更多相关文章

  1. dubbo管控台安装

    1. jdk安装 #  cp installpkgs/jdk-7u67-linux-x64_tar_gz /usr/local #  tar -zxf jdk-7u67-linux-x64_tar_g ...

  2. Dubbo管控台安装(zookeeper集群)

    Dubbo管控台可以对注册到zookeeper注册中心的服务或服务消费者进行管理,但管控台是否正常对Dubbo服务没有影响,管控台也不需要高可用,因此节点部署   环境:Centos6.6.IP:10 ...

  3. Dubbo-Centos7管控台安装

    1.下载Tomcat7: $ wget http://mirrors.hust.edu.cn/apache/tomcat/tomcat-7/v7.0.57/bin/apache-tomcat-7.0. ...

  4. centos6.5安装dubbo管控台教程(四)

    阅读此文之前,需要先安装zookeeper. 阅读文章: http://www.cnblogs.com/duenboa/articles/6665169.html   1. 下载文件 dubbo-ad ...

  5. Linux 安装Zookeeper<单机版>(使用Mac远程访问)

    阅读本文需要先阅读安装Zookeeper<准备> 新建目录 mkdir /usr/local/zookeeper 解压 cd zookeeper压缩包所在目录 tar -xvf zooke ...

  6. Windows安装zookeeper 单机版

    首先需要安装JdK,从Oracle的Java网站下载,安装很简单,就不再详述. 1.下载zookeeper, https://mirrors.tuna.tsinghua.edu.cn/apache/z ...

  7. ZooKeeper教程(一)----Centos7下安装ZooKeeper(单机版)

    1.下载源码 官网下载地址: http://mirrors.hust.edu.cn/apache/zookeeper/ 选择最新的版本进行下载 这里选择3.4.10进行下载: wget http:// ...

  8. windows安装zookeeper单机版

    1.在apache的官方网站提供了好多镜像下载地址,然后找到对应的版本,目前最新的是3.4.6下载地址:http://mirrors.cnnic.cn/apache/zookeeper/zookeep ...

  9. Linux 启动dubbo管控台:

随机推荐

  1. ContOS7编译安装python3,配置虚拟环境

    Python36编译安装 一,下载python源码包 网址:https://www.python.org/downloads/release/python-367/ # 软件包下载到/opt目录 cd ...

  2. DrawableAnimation小练习

    DrawableAnimation,也就是帧动画,将图片一张张显示出来,从而形成动画的效果 先在项目文件夹下新建一个目录drawable,然后在里面新建一个xml文件,自定义文件名,我的叫my_ani ...

  3. SpringBoot整合ssm

    1.创建工程 使用idea可以快速创建SpringBoot的工程 这里选择常用的类库,SpringBoot将各种框架类库都进行了封装,可以减少pom文件中的引用配置: 比如Spring和Mybatis ...

  4. 线性基求第k小异或值

    题目链接 题意:给由 n 个数组成的一个可重集 S,每次给定一个数 k,求一个集合 \(T \subseteq S\), 使得集合 T 在 S 的所有非空子集的不同的异或和中, 其异或和 \(T_1 ...

  5. Hdoj 2563.统计问题 题解

    Problem Description 在一无限大的二维平面中,我们做如下假设: 1. 每次只能移动一格: 2. 不能向后走(假设你的目的地是"向上",那么你可以向左走,可以向右走 ...

  6. [luogu5003]跳舞的线【动态规划】

    题目描述 线现在在一个地图上,它正在(1,1)上(左上角),最终要去到(M,N)上.它不但只能往下或往右走,还只能在整数格子上移动. Imakf有的时候想要炫技,又有时想偷懒,所以他会告诉你这张地图的 ...

  7. js排序算法总结

    快速排序 大致分三步: 1.找基准(一般是以中间项为基准) 2.遍历数组,小于基准的放在left,大于基准的放在right 3.递归 快速排序的平均时间复杂度是O(nlogn),最差情况是O(n²). ...

  8. sublime text3 插件的安装

    ctrl + shift +p 打开搜索框界面 安装: 输入install package并回车,再在列表中选中所需要安装的插件,你会发现左下角正在显示安装.安装成功后,一般会打开插件说明. 卸载: ...

  9. jsp model1

    一.model1(纯jsp技术): 1.dao:data access object,数据访问对象,即专门对数据库进行操作的类,一般说dao不含业务逻辑. 2.当进行跳转时候,需要用servlet来实 ...

  10. js 正则表达式的使用(标志 RegExp exec() test() compile() $1...$9)

    一,标志 g (global,全局匹配标志) 执行正则表达式匹配或替换时,一般只要搜索到一个符合的文本就停止匹配或替换.使用该标志将搜索所有符合的文本直到文本末尾. i (ignoreCase,忽略大 ...